#6857c2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6857c2 is composed of 40.8% red, 34.1% green and 76.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 46.4% cyan, 55.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.9% black. It has a hue angle of 249.5 degrees, a saturation of 46.7% and a lightness of 55.1%. #6857c2 color hex could be obtained by blending #d0aeff with #000085.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

#6857c2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6857c2 has RGB values of R:104, G:87, B:194 and CMYK values of C:0.46, M:0.55, Y:0,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 6838210.
